What is another word for contribute?

Synonyms for contribute
kənˈtrɪb yutcon·trib·ute

This thesaurus page includes all potential synonyms, words with the same meaning and similar terms for the word contribute.

Complete Dictionary of Synonyms and Antonyms3.1 / 11 votes

  1. contribute

    Synonyms:
    conduce, add, subscribe, give, co-operate, assist, tend, supply

    Antonyms:
    refuse, withhold, misconduct, misapply, contravene
